Key Responsibilities
- Develop new procedures and Best Known Methods (BKMs) to service new products
- Participate in or own first chamber Build & Test in Apps lab
- Solve issues, or work with Engineering to address issues identified
- Work with Manufacturing to develop procedures and participate (if required) on New Product final test
- Drive resolution of key issues with Engineering. Own beta site test plans and reporting
- Partner with Quality & Reliability (Q&R) group to review and address Top Field Issues
- Participate in or own CAPA process
- Identify new parts that require to be stocked by AGS and work with them to ensure parts are stocked in correct locations
